Periodic Façade Inspections: Safeguarding Buildings for the Future

Image
  Towering skyscrapers, iconic architectural designs, and a growing focus on sustainability define the urban landscape. While aesthetics often capture attention, the true measure of a building’s resilience lies in its safety and longevity. One crucial aspect of building maintenance is the periodic façade inspection (PFI) , a process mandated in Singapore and increasingly emphasized worldwide. Façades, the outer skins of buildings, are constantly exposed to weather, pollution, and time. If neglected, they can pose significant risks to public safety and undermine property value. This blog explores why periodic façade inspections are critical today and how they will remain vital in the next five years. It highlights their role in safety, compliance, technology adoption, and future-proofing urban environments. The Role of Periodic Checks in Protecting Public Safety

Image
Singapore’s skyline is a defining part of its identity, a mix of shimmering glass towers, residential high-rises, and heritage architecture. While these structures are built to last, they are constantly exposed to weather, pollution, and time. Over the years, this exposure has led to gradual wear and tear that, if left unchecked, can pose serious risks to the public. This is why periodic checks are more than just routine maintenance; they are an essential public safety measure. Whether it’s a routine building assessment or a facade inspection in Singapore , these checks ensure that potential hazards are detected early, repairs are made promptly, and accidents are prevented before they happen. In this blog, we’ll explore why periodic checks matter, how they protect public safety, what the Singapore regulations require, and how building owners can integrate them into a long-term safety strategy.
